Monitor Court Mentions → Analyze Sentiment → Alert Legal Team
Track mentions of ongoing cases or key personnel across news and social media, analyze public sentiment, and alert legal teams to potential PR issues or case developments.
Workflow Steps
Mention.com
Set up monitoring for case-related keywords
Create alerts for your client names, case numbers, opposing counsel, and relevant legal terms. Set up separate monitors for news sites, social media, and legal publications. Configure real-time notifications for high-priority mentions.
OpenAI GPT-4
Analyze sentiment and extract key insights
Process each mention through GPT-4 to determine sentiment (positive/negative/neutral), identify potential reputation risks, extract key quotes, and assess the credibility of the source. Flag mentions that could impact jury selection or case strategy.
Zapier
Filter and prioritize alerts
Create a filter system that only sends high-priority alerts (negative sentiment from major publications, mentions of settlement discussions, or quotes from opposing parties) to avoid notification overload.
Slack
Send formatted alerts to legal team
Send structured alerts to a dedicated legal team Slack channel with the article link, sentiment score, key quotes, and recommended actions. Include different alert levels (urgent, moderate, informational) with appropriate formatting and emoji indicators.

Why This Works
Provides early warning of negative coverage or case developments, allowing legal teams to respond quickly to protect client reputation and adjust case strategy based on public perception.
Best For
Legal teams managing high-profile cases with media attention
